Kathmandu, Jan. 22 -- Hundreds of people in multiple vehicles escorted Rastriya Swatantra Party (RSP) senior leader Balendra (Balen) Shah as he filed his nomination in Jhapa constituency-5 on Tuesday. Projected by the party as its prime ministerial candidate, Shah was seen openly breaching the Election Commission's code of conduct and its directive to refrain from extravagance.

The scene at the nomination of CPN-UML chair KP Sharma Oli, Shah's rival in the constituency, was no different. On the very first day of the election race, both prominent figures openly challenged the constitutional commission and long-established electoral norms.
